The Leopard Ball Python is a pattern and colouration altering mutation that is known to enhance the colour of combo offspring. The name Leopard comes from the bright yellows that were on show when the first Spider Leopard and Pastel Leopard were first produced in 2005. The Wrecking Ball Ball Python is an Incomplete Dominant trait. The single gene Wrecking Ball has a extremely unique wobbly/melted pattern and was originally believed to be connected in some way to the Piebald mutation. This is a combination morph using Spotnose, which is an incomplete dominant gene, and Clown, which is a recessive gene.The Hidden Gene Woma Ball Python is a colour and pattern altering mutation that is suspected, yet unproven, to be part of the Spider Complex. Despite its name, the Hidden Gene Woma doesn't actually contain any "hidden genes" and is a completely separate mutation to the Woma Ball Python. The fact that they are visually extremely similar has led to more confusion around the genes.The Orange Dream Spotnose Fire Ball Python gives us a glimpse of this gene's potential. The GHI was first proved genetic by Matt Lerer after finding three identical and unusual Ball Pythons in a shipment of imported animals.Pinstripe is a good example of a dominant gene in Ball Pythons. Pinstripe does not have a "super" form (homozygous genotype) that looks any different from a snake that is heterozygous for Pinstripe. (Updated December 2022) Incomplete Dominant Pastel Highway The Pastel Ball Python is a single gene incomplete dominant morph. Breed two together and you can get a Super Pastel, which is the homozygous form of the morph. Though Pastel is beautiful in its own right, you most often see it in combinations with other genes. There are so ma...An Ivory Ball Python is one that has two copies of the Yellow Belly gene. The Yellow Belly gene is incomplete dominant in its heterozygous form. In its homozygous form (the Ivory), however, it achieves full dominance, and completely changes the snake’s pattern. About. The Desert Ghost Ball Python is a recessive, colour and pattern altering mutation that has several distinct lines. Most lines are known to be compatible with one another, such as the Bell DG, NERD DG and the Enhancer DG lines, whereas others, such as Sahara DG, are incompatible to current understanding.
